site stats

Clickhouse insert_dataframe

WebInserting Data into ClickHouse ClickHouse is a database, so there are countless ways to ingest data. There is no special tool designed just for inserting data into ClickHouse. So how do users get data in? Options include: simply uploading a CSV file to ClickHouse Cloud as discussed in the Quick Start

[Code]-Pandas: How to insert dataframe into Clickhouse-pandas

WebFeb 9, 2024 · Describe the bug insert_dataframe doesn't support columns with Nullable() function To Reproduce from clickhouse_driver import Client from pandas import Dataframe as df client = Client('localhost', settings={'use_numpy': True}) client.exe... WebWriting pandas DataFrame is also supported with insert_dataframe: >>> client = Client('localhost', settings={'use_numpy': True}) >>> client.execute( ... 'CREATE TABLE test (x Int64, y Int64) Engine = Memory' ... ) >>> [] >>> df = client.query_dataframe( ... 'SELECT number AS x, (number + 100) AS y ' ... community property and divorce https://staticdarkness.com

INSERT INTO - ClickHouse Documentation

WebClickhouse-driver is designed to communicate with ClickHouse server from Python over native protocol. ClickHouse server provides two protocols for communication: HTTP protocol (port 8123 by default); Native (TCP) protocol (port 9000 by default). Each protocol has own advantages and disadvantages. Here we focus on advantages of native protocol: WebMar 12, 2024 · 如查询数据表: ```julia using DataFrames df = DataFrame(DB.query(db, "SELECT * FROM tablename")) ``` 插入数据 ```julia DB.execute(db, "INSERT INTO tablename (column1, column2) VALUES (1, 'a')") ``` 关闭连接 ```julia DB.disconnect(db) ``` 上面的代码只是简单的示例,具体的使用方式可以参考DB.jl包的文档。 WebSyntax. INSERT INTO [db.]table [(c1, c2, c3)] FROM INFILE file_name [COMPRESSION type] FORMAT format_name. Use the syntax above to insert data from a file, or files, … community property agreement wa state

How to connect to ClickHouse with Python using SQLAlchemy

Category:clickhouse-driver Documentation - Read the Docs

Tags:Clickhouse insert_dataframe

Clickhouse insert_dataframe

Quickstart — clickhouse-driver 0.2.6 documentation

WebInsert queries in Native protocol are a little bit tricky because of ClickHouse’s columnar nature. And because we’re using Python. INSERT query consists of two parts: query statement and query values. Query values are split into chunks called blocks. Each block is sent in binary columnar form. This works very well. It is very easy, and is more efficient than using client.execute("INSERT INTO your_table VALUES", df.to_dict('records')) because it will transpose the DataFrame and send the data in columnar format. This doesn't do automatic table generation, but I wouldn't trust that anyway.

Clickhouse insert_dataframe

Did you know?

WebMar 8, 2024 · 可以通过以下语句在 ClickHouse 中添加索引: ALTER TABLE table_name ADD INDEX index_name(column_name); 其中,table_name 是要添加索引的表名,index_name 是索引的名称,column_name 是要添加索引的列名。 WebMar 31, 2024 · Writing to the clickhouse database is similar to writing any other database through JDBC. Just make sure to import the ClickHouseDriver class to your code. The username and password are passed into the ckProperties object. The write command is as follows, you can replace the database name in the string:

WebInsert queries inNative protocolare a little bit tricky because of ClickHouse’s columnar nature. And because we’re using Python. INSERT query consists of two parts: query statement and query values. Query values are split into chunks called blocks. Each block is sent in binary columnar form. WebOur latest webinar, hosted by Robert Hodges (Altinity CEO), is a gentle introduction to ClickHouse internals, focusing on topics that will help your applicat...

WebSep 5, 2024 · what would be the best method to get data from clickhouse to python pandas dataframe? client = Client (host='localhost', port=xxxx, database='yyyy') query_result = … WebSep 5, 2024 · what would be the best method to get data from clickhouse to python pandas dataframe? At the moment, I am using: from clickhouse_driver import Client client = Client (host='localhost',...

http://www.devdoc.net/database/ClickhouseDocs_19.4.1.3-docs/query_language/insert_into/

Webclickhouse:// creates a normal TCP socket connection clickhouses:// creates a SSL wrapped TCP socket connection. Any additional querystring arguments will be passed … community property care limitedWebsqlalchemy-clickhouse cannot create table automatically (at least until version 0.1.5.post0 inclusively) and interprets any sql-query of table creation as SELECT-query that always … easy to use time clocksWebFeb 25, 2024 · For example, you select normalized array data from ClickHouse data frame, then use the DataFrame.pivot_table() method to pivot rows and columns. See the EX-4 … community property and inheritance